CE light meters are instruments used for measuring the intensity or illuminance of light in a given area. They are commonly used in various fields, including photography, film production, architecture, interior design, and environmental monitoring. Here are some key points about CE light meters:

  1. Purpose: CE light meters are designed to measure the level of visible light in lux or foot-candles. They provide accurate readings of how bright a particular space or object is, helping professionals make informed decisions regarding lighting.

  2. Measurement Units: Light meters can display readings in different units, such as lux (metric) or foot-candles (imperial). The choice of unit depends on the user's preference and the industry standards in their field.

  3. Types: There are various types of CE light meters available, including digital and analog models. Digital light meters typically provide precise readings and may have additional features like data logging and data transfer capabilities. Analog light meters use a needle or dial to display measurements and are often simpler to use.

  4. Applications:

    • Photography: Photographers use light meters to measure ambient light and adjust camera settings, such as aperture and shutter speed, for optimal exposure.
    • Film Production: Cinematographers use light meters to ensure consistent lighting levels on film sets, helping maintain visual consistency in scenes.
    • Architecture and Interior Design: Professionals in these fields use light meters to assess natural and artificial lighting in spaces to create functional and aesthetically pleasing environments.
    • Environmental Monitoring: Researchers and scientists use light meters to study natural light conditions in various ecosystems, which can be crucial for understanding plant growth and animal behavior.
  5. Calibration: CE light meters should be periodically calibrated to maintain accuracy. Calibration ensures that the readings provided by the meter are reliable and consistent over time.

  6. Features: Some modern CE light meters come with additional features, such as data storage, data analysis, and the ability to measure color temperature or spectral distribution of light.

  7. Portability: Light meters are often designed to be portable and easy to carry, making them convenient for on-site measurements.

  8. Cost: The price of CE light meters can vary significantly depending on their features and precision. Entry-level models may be more affordable, while professional-grade meters with advanced capabilities can be more expensive.

When selecting a CE light meter, it's essential to consider the specific requirements of your application, including the desired measurement range, accuracy, and any additional features needed for your work.Additionally, ensure that the meter meets any industry or regulatory standards relevant to your field of use.

Brief Introduction of Pupil Distance Meter and Pupil Distance

PD Meter: a precision optical instrument used to measure distance between human pupils in the process of optometry for fitting spectacles.

Pupil Distance:

Binocular Pupil Distance VS Monocular Pupil Distance

Binocular PD: the distance from the center of the pupil of the two eyes.

Monocular PD: the distance from the center of the pupil of the right or left eye to the nasal centreline.

One-eyed, squinted, especially those who need progressive multifocal lenses, need to measure their monocular pupil distance.

◆Distant Pupil Distance VS Near Pupil Distance

Distant PD: the distance between the pupil centers of two eyes when they are looking at the infinite distance.

Near PD(NCD): the distance between the pupil centers when gazing at a near target, that is, when reading at 30-40 cm or working at close distance.

Near pupil distance is always smaller than distant pupil distance.
